Nick Kyrgios and Fabio Fognini were meant to have a tasty first-round match in Sydney on Monday. Unfortunately, that will not happen after the Australian player withdraws from the tournament for the second consecutive week. Nick declined to play in Melbourne last week, saying that he was struggling with asthma (but he confirmed he didn’t have covid at that time).

Kyrgios will play the Australian Open

However, now it has been confirmed that this time Nick tested positive for Covid. Fortunately he has no symptoms and he is positive he will play the Australian Open. He released the following statement.

“Hey Everyone, I just want to be open and transparent with everyone, the reason I have had to pull out of Sydney is because I tested positive for Covid. I am feeling healthy at the moment with no symptoms. I wish everyone all the best and to stay safe where you can. If all goes well I will see you all at The Australian Open.”

 

Fabio Fognini will play against lucky loser Daniel Altmaier.
